Safety devices

2.4.1

Fundamental aspects

Check the safety equipment and locking devices on the
device for safe operational condition.
Only operate the device if all safety devices are present
and enabled. The operating company or operator of the
compact flame controller is responsible for the proper op-
eration of the device.
The device has been fitted with warning and danger signs
for the protection of operating staff. These signs have to
be observed. Damaged or illegible signs have to be re-
placed immediately.
2.4.2
Safety devices on the compact flame
controller
The compact flame controller is equipped with the follow-
ing safety devices:
 Housing (protection against accidental contact)
 Pressure barriers (optional)
 Locking device (optional)
 Purge air connection
 Heating insulator (optional)
